United States Stove Company KP5517
United States Stove Company KP5517 is a non-catalytic pellet stove from United States Stove Company certified at 1.6 g/hr particulate emissions with 77% HHV efficiency and a 11,871–30,884 BTU/h output range.

Frequently asked questions
Is the United States Stove Company KP5517 EPA certified?
Yes, the United States Stove Company KP5517 is on the EPA's current list of certified wood heaters (certification number 319- 22) and meets the 2020 NSPS Step 2 emission limits.
What is the United States Stove Company KP5517's emission rate?
The United States Stove Company KP5517 is certified at 1.6 grams of particulates per hour (tested with wood pellets). Real-world emissions depend heavily on fuel moisture and operation — the lab figure assumes seasoned fuel and correct air settings.
How many square feet can the United States Stove Company KP5517 heat?
Roughly 900–1,250 sq ft, estimated from its 30,884 BTU/h peak output at 25–35 BTU/h per square foot. Insulation, climate, ceiling height, and floor plan move this figure substantially in both directions.
Does the United States Stove Company KP5517 qualify for a federal tax credit?
No — the federal 25C credit for biomass stoves was terminated for property placed in service after December 31, 2025. The United States Stove Company KP5517's certified efficiency is 77% HHV, which met the credit's ≥75% HHV threshold while it existed. State and local incentive programs may still apply — check your state energy office and air district.
